The Technocracy Study Course is a technocratic critique of the price system, written by M. King Hubbert and first published in 1934. It is the ideological basis for the Technocracy movement, highlighting economic and social consequences of the capitalist price system and suggests an alternative socioeconomic system based on physical laws and constraints. The technocracy movement is a social movement which arose in the early 20th century. Technocracy was popular in the United States and Canada for a brief period in the early 1930s, before it was overshadowed by other proposals for dealing with the crisis of the Great Depression. The technocracy movement proposed replacing politicians and businesspeople with scientists and engineers who had the technical expertise to manage the economy.

The Hubbert curve is an approximation of the production rate of a resource over time. It is a symmetric logistic distribution curve, often confused with the "normal" gaussian function. It first appeared in "Nuclear Energy and the Fossil Fuels," geologist M. King Hubbert's 1956 presentation to the American Petroleum Institute, as an idealized symmetric curve, during his tenure at the Shell Oil Company. It has gained a high degree of popularity in the scientific community for predicting the depletion of various natural resources. The curve is the main component of Hubbert peak theory, which has led to the rise of peak oil concerns. Basing his calculations on the peak of oil well discovery in 1948, Hubbert used his model in 1956 to create a curve which predicted that oil production in the contiguous United States would peak around 1970.

Peak oil is the theorized point in time when the maximum rate of extraction of petroleum is reached, after which it is expected to enter terminal decline. Peak oil theory is based on the observed rise, peak, fall, and depletion of aggregate production rate in oil fields over time. It is often confused with oil depletion; however, whereas depletion refers to a period of falling reserves and supply, peak oil refers to the point of maximum production. The concept of peak oil is often credited to geologist M. King Hubbert whose 1956 paper first presented a formal theory.

The term Peak coal is used to refer to the point in time at which coal production and consumption reaches its maximum, after which, it is assumed, production and consumption will decline steadily. The term was originally used in connection with M. King Hubbert's Hubbert peak theory, in which the finite nature of the resource determines a constraint on production. However, since the expansion of renewable energy particularly in electricity generation, the term is now commonly used with reference to a peak in coal demand, which may already have occurred.

Peak minerals marks the point in time when the largest production of a mineral will occur in an area, with production declining in subsequent years. While most mineral resources will not be exhausted in the near future, global extraction and production is becoming more challenging. Miners have found ways over time to extract deeper and lower grade ores with lower production costs. More than anything else, declining average ore grades are indicative of ongoing technological shifts that have enabled inclusion of more 'complex' processing – in social and environmental terms as well as economic – and structural changes in the minerals exploration industry and these have been accompanied by significant increases in identified Mineral Reserves.

The Engineers and the Price System, by Thorstein Veblen, is a compilation of a series of papers originally published in The Dial in 1919, each of which mainly analyzes and criticizes the price system, planned obsolescence, and artificial scarcity. The final chapter outlined a plan for a "soviet of technicians".
